**Item 4 — Lifts, weekend maintenance**

Lifts at Tarnley Block are offline Saturdays 06:00–14:00. Night shift: use stairwell C only. Fire doors self-lock behind you, so plan your route. Goods lift stays live for emergencies; duty engineer must authorise each use. Log every stairwell entry in the night book at the west desk. Stairwell C's keypad replaces badge readers during maintenance. Enter the code below.

door code, yagap-bahof: bdg-O-05

Heads up: the Mosswick orphaned-resource sweeper started deleting test fixtures mid-run because CI tagging lagged behind provisioning. We added a 10-minute grace window and a tag-presence check before reaping, and the flaky deploy jobs went green again. Safe to cut the release once you confirm the sweeper build token below.

session token of tajog-fahaf = htk21_4ae55819f45410afcb307

MEMO — Kettling Depot Receiving

Uniform sets for the new Kettling depot arrive Wednesday via Ashgrove courier: 40 boxes, sorted by size, manifest attached to box one. Check the count at the dock before signing; shortages go straight to stores, not the courier. The hand-over instruction the courier will follow is set out below.

drop instructions, tafof-baguf: the holmir gilox courier leaves the sormir ulaok holdor ledger at gate 5596 under passcode 257343